Brazil Inflation Rate 1990s

Consumer price inflation, annual % · World Bank
843.25% decade average (1990-1999)

Brazil's inflation rate during the 1990s ranged from 3.20% (1998) to 2,947.73% (1990), averaging 843.25% over 10 years of data.
